What you’ll need

1
75 g elbow macaroni
2
150 ml water
3
50 ml milk
4
50 g cheddar cheese, grated
5
10 g butter
6
Salt, to taste
7
Pepper, to taste
8
A pinch of paprika (optional)

How to make it

1

In a small pot, bring 150 ml of water to a boil. Add the 75 g of elbow macaroni and a pinch of salt. Cook for about 8-10 minutes until the pasta is al dente.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king—your patience will be rewarded with perfect pasta!

2

Once the macaroni is cooked, drain any excess water, but leave a tablespoon or so in the pot for extra creaminess. Add 50 ml of milk and 10 g of butter to the pot, stirring until the butter melts and everything is well combined.

3

Lower the heat and mix in the 50 g of grated cheddar cheese. Stir continuously until the cheese is melted and the sauce is creamy and smooth. If you’re feeling adventurous, sprinkle in a pinch of paprika to elevate the flavor and add a lovely color to your dish.

4

Season with salt and pepper to taste, then give it one last stir to ensure every macaroni piece is coated with that cheesy goodness.

5

Serve hot in a cozy bowl, and enjoy the warmth of this classic dish!
